La Cueva in the region of Hidalgo is a town located in Mexico - some 97 mi or ( 157 km ) North-East of Mexico City , the country's capital .

Texcatepec

Texcatepec is a municipality located in the north zone in the State of Veracruz, about 190 km from state capital Xalapa. It has a surface of 153.61 km2. In 1930 the municipal head-board was established in the village of Amexac; but for the decree number 4 in 1931 returned the character of municipal head-board, to the village of Texcatepec.

Ixhuatlán de Madero

Ixhuatlán de Madero is a Municipality in Veracruz, Mexico. It is located in north zone of the State of Veracruz, about 376 km from state capital Xalapa. It has a surface of 598.81 km2. The municipality of Ixhuatlán de Madero is delimited to the north by Chicontepec de Tejeda, to the east by Temapache, to the south by Hidalgo State and Puebla State and to the west by Tlachichilco and Benito Juárez.
